Understanding Solar Powered Toy Cars
Solar powered toy cars are powered by solar panels that convert sunlight into energy, allowing them to move without batteries. These toys are designed to engage children in hands-on learning experiences, helping them understand the basics of solar energy and its applications. Not only do they encourage outdoor play, but they also instill an appreciation for renewable energy sources, an essential concept in today’s world.

Do solar toy cars work in cloudy weather?
While solar toy cars primarily rely on direct sunlight, they may still operate in cloudy conditions, though their performance will be reduced. It’s best to use them on sunny days for optimal fun.

Can solar toy cars be used indoors?
Solar toy cars require sunlight to function, so they are best suited for outdoor use. However, they can be used indoors during the day if there is sufficient sunlight coming through windows.

Do I need to buy batteries for solar-powered toy cars?
Most solar-powered toy cars do not require batteries, as they operate directly on solar energy. Some kits may have battery backups for use in low-light conditions.
